1. Новые складчины Показать еще

    12.12.2017: Исполняющие желания дни месяца Крысы 07.12.2017-05.01.2018

    12.12.2017: Код Geometria. Деньги на репортажке (Артур "Steel")

    12.12.2017: С нуля до первых 100 000 в бизнесе на предоставлении услуг грузчиков (Сергей Парамонов)

    12.12.2017: SithiSound.Обретение дара целителя (Андрей Дуйко)

    12.12.2017: Предназначение 108 (Роман Тюльмаев)

  2. Гость, если у Вас на каком либо сайте есть аккаунт с повышенным статусом, то и у нас вы можете получить соответствующий статус. Подробнее читайте здесь https://www.skladchik.biz/threads/83942/
    Скрыть объявление
  3. Нужен организатор Показать еще

    11.12.2017: Обережная и гармонизирующая магия дома и его пространств (Лана Палагнюк-Симаненко)

    10.12.2017: Алмазная спина [GIPERBAREA, Игорь Fresh Ковалёв]

    08.12.2017: Цикл "Стилистика как бизнес" (Анна Шарлай)

    04.12.2017: 2 миллиона в месяц на продаже студий - Андрей Сазонов

    04.12.2017: Биология (Videouroki) 6-7 класс

  4. Сбор взносов Показать еще

    08.12.2017: [amlab.me] Основы работы со вспышками (Алексей Гайдин)

    02.12.2017: 15 способов удвоить трафик и увеличить активность подписчиков в Инстаграм (Ксения Потапова)

    11.11.2017: Бизнес Коучинг (Андрей Парабеллум)

    07.11.2017: Курс по работе и заработку с Telegram

    23.07.2017: Pоwer Еnglish Clаss (Наташа Купep)

Открыто [CBS] ASP.NET Advanced

Тема в разделе "Курсы по программированию", создана пользователем Менеджер, 15 авг 2013.

Цена:
8880р.
Взнос:
97р.

Список пока что пуст. Запишитесь первым!

    Тип: Стандартная складчина
    Участников: 0/100
  1. 15 авг 2013
    #1
    Менеджер
    Менеджер Организатор Организатор

    [CBS] ASP.NET Advanced

    Описание курса ASP.NET Углубленный курс

    ASP.NET давно закрепился на рынке веб технологий, как гибкая и мощная платформа. Многие разработчики могут создать страницы с набором элементов управления и привязкой к базе данных, но не все разработчики в полной мере могут манипулировать генерируемым HTML кодом, создавать свои элементы управления и модули, оптимизировать страницы и создавать быстрые веб порталы. Углубленный курс ASP.NET позволяет слушателю разобрать механизмы работы приложения и принципы обработки запросов на стороне сервера. Данный курс будет незаменим для тех, кто хочет понять, как работают сложные серверные элементы управления, через какие модули проходит каждый запрос адресованный приложению и что происходит внутри IIS.[/SIZE]

    Содержание курса:
    Урок 1. Архитектура IIS7
    Архитектура IIS7, основные компоненты и принципы обработки запросов. Детальный разбор жизненного цикла страницы и жизненного цикла приложения. Файл Global.asax.


    Урок 2. HTTP обработчики и HTTP модули
    Разработка и регистрация пользовательских HTTP обработчиков. Ashx файлы и обработчики как C# классы. Рассмотрение понятия HTTP модуль, разработка и регистрация HTTP модулей.

    . Асинхронное программирование в ASP.NET
    Обзор инструментов для асинхронного программирования в .NET. Класс Thread и асинхронные методы.
    Создание асинхронных страниц. Работа с асинхронными задачами. Разработка асинхронных обработчиков. Сравнение производительности веб приложения при использовании разных типов страниц.

    4. Пользовательские элементы управления
    Разработка и регистрация пользовательских элементов управления (UserControl). Динамическая загрузка пользовательских элементов управления. Разработка элементов связанных с данными.

    Урок 5. Специализированные элементы управления
    Создание специализированных элементов управления. Выбор базового типа для специализированного элемента управления. Регистрация элемента управления в веб приложении.

    6. Элементы управления связанные с данными
    Создание специализированных элементов управления связанных с данными. Разработка пользовательских списочных элементов управления. Создание контролов использующих шаблоны.

    7. Поддержка элементов управления во время разработки
    Рассмотрение архитектуры .NET времени разработки. Рассмотрение атрибутов-метаданных. Рендеринг значений разных типов.
    Рассмотрение принципов функционирования выражений в ASP.NET (<% … %>)

    8. Кэширование
    Кэширование данных приложения. Настройка кэширования вывода (Output Cache). Рекомендации по использованию кэширования в ASP.NET

    9. Безопасность в ASP.NET
    Контекст защиты ASP.NET и механизмы аутентификации IIS. Рассмотрение защиты на уровне конвейера ASP.NET. Углубленное рассмотрение аутентификации Forms. Работа с классом FormsAuthentication.
    MembershipProvider и MembershipRole примеры использования провайдеров и элементов связанных с безопасностью.
    Что такое SQL инъекция, как разрабатывать безопасные страницы. Межсайтовый скриптинг (Cross-Site Scripting) и способы избежать его на страницах веб приложения.

    Урок 10. Страницы с элементами WebParts
    Назначение WebParts. Создание и подключение WebParts. WebPartZone разработка порталов основанных на WebParts. Связывание WebParts.


    По завершению курса Вы сможете:

    • Вы сможете разрабатывать HTTP модули и обработчики
    • Создавать сложные пользовательские элементы управления
    • Создавать элементы управления, использующие шаблоны
    • Создавать специализированные элементы управления, которые, как и элементы ASP.NET, будут храниться в отдельных библиотеках
    • Повышать общую производительность веб сервера используя кэширование и асинхронные страницы
    • Создавать веб приложения использую MembershipProvider и RoleProvider, что позволит Вам ускорить процесс реализации задач авторизации, аутентификации и регистрации
    • Создавать безопасные страницы. Вы научитесь избегать SQL инъекции и межсайтового скриптинга (XSS)
    • Разрабатывать WebParts


     
    Последнее редактирование модератором: 1 фев 2015
  2. Похожие складчины
    1. Злата
    2. Lesov
    3. Злата
    4. hp4s
    5. Менеджер
      Открыто [CBS] ASP.NET Essential
    6. Менеджер
      Открыто [CBS] ASP.NET Ajax
    7. Менеджер
      Открыто [CBS] SEO на ASP.NET
    Загрузка...

Участники складчины [CBS] ASP.NET Advanced смогут написать отзыв